When scrolling with touchscreen starting from text, as soon as touch leaves the text span, the touch event stops, making touch-scrolling able to scroll one row only. This fixes it by setting `pointer-events: none` to text spans, excluding them from hit-testing so that touch events won't be constrained to them. Fixes xtermjs#3613

Trying to scroll the terminal window can still be a challenge if there’s a lot of data on the screen like when the screen fills with error messages. It seems you need to start your scroll with your finger in an area where there is no text. When the screen is full of text, that’s difficult. Here’s a short video demonstrating the issue. I turned on Assistive touch to demonstrate the problem.
You can see how if I try to start my scroll with my finger on some text, it ignores the scroll. If I start it where there is no text, scroll works fine.
This issue reproduces only on iOS. Android works fine.
